Charlotte W. Lindemann

THE BALTIMORE EVENING SUN

Charlotte W. Lindemann, a top salesperson for the Coldwell Banker real estate company, died Saturday at Levindale Hebrew Geriatric Center after a series of strokes. She lived on Park Grove Avenue in Catonsville.

A Mass of Christian burial for Mrs. Lindemann will be offered at 10 a.m. tomorrow at St. Mark Roman Catholic Church, 30 Melvin Ave., Catonsville.

Mrs. Lindemann began working for what was then Russell T. Baker & Co. in 1977, and she became the leading salesperson after three years. For the next eight years, she was the top residential housing salesperson in the Baltimore area for what became Coldwell Banker.

She retired in 1988 after her first stroke.

The former Charlotte Wood was a native of Alexandria, Va., and a graduate of Warrenton (Va.) High School and James Madison University.

She came to the Baltimore area in the late 1940s and taught business courses at Catonsville High School for a time.

She is survived by her husband, Harley B. Lindemann, and a son, William C. Lindemann of San Francisco.
